Bellusci is a very good player, technically. He's a ball-playing central defender in the "stopper" style, ie a Baresi-type who'll step out of defence, step on someone's leg, steal the ball then stride forward with it into attack.
He'll easily be good enough for the Greek top division.

However, he is a hot-head and one minute may be saving your team before then getting sent off for a ridiculous, rash and unnecessary challenge. Or he may curl a free-kick into the top corner from 30m out before scoring an own goal at the other end.

He never has a steady 7/10 game.

The reason he's hated is because he's thought to be one of six players who "phoned in sick" before a match, ie the 6 in question said they had an injury and couldn't play at very short notice, leaving us high and dry.
The fans never forgave him for that.

So he's a good player if you can keep his head on right, but he's an arrogant SOB at the same time.
